> On list elements of `org-publish-project-alist' with :base-extension any
> `org-publish-get-project-from-filename' fails with error
> (wrong-type-argument sequencep any). This is due to the `concat' call in
> `org-publish-get-project-from-filename' where it attempts to construct a
> regex by concatenating several strings together. When extension `x' is
> any (a symbol), this step fails.
Fixed. Thank you.
